The AC-HPAT Biology exam is a critical entrance assessment
designed for students aspiring to enter competitive health science and medical
programs. Rather than a standalone certification, this exam acts as a rigorous
filter, evaluating a candidate's readiness for the academic demands of
healthcare education. It is specifically tailored for individuals who are
serious about pursuing careers in medicine, occupational therapy, speech and
language therapy, and other allied health professions where a profound
understanding of biological systems is essential.
What the Course Entails and Exam Details
This comprehensive biology assessment covers a diverse
syllabus, focusing on the foundational knowledge required for future healthcare
practitioners. Candidates are expected to demonstrate proficiency in core
topics such as cellular biology (structure, function, and processes like
respiration and photosynthesis), human physiology (the integration of major
organ systems), genetics (inheritance patterns and molecular biology), ecology,
and evolutionary biology. The exam does not merely test theoretical recall; it
is structured to assess your ability to synthesize this knowledge and apply
biological principles to solve complex problems and analyze realistic scenarios
encountered in a healthcare environment.
What to Expect in the Final Exam
You should prepare for a demanding, timed examination
predominantly composed of multiple-choice questions (MCQs). Each question is
meticulously crafted, offering multiple plausible options that require sharp
critical thinking and scientific discernment to navigate. Beyond standard
factual questions, the final exam includes situational analysis problems that
require applying theory to practical cases, as well as data interpretation
tasks based on graphs, charts, and experimental results. Precision and time
management are paramount, as you will need to complete the section within a
strict timeframe. While specific passing scores can vary significantly by the
academic program and institution you are applying to, high performance on the
biology component is universally advantageous.
